⚫ Trigger level
Trigger level occurs when trigger source signal reaches specified trigger
level with specified trigger slope. When the [Knob] soft key is pressed and
“T/Lev” is selected, the trigger level can be adjusted by rotating the knob. In
this case, the trigger level can be changed by rotating the knob, and
changes in the trigger level can be observed on the screen.
5.2 Setting of Knob Functions
The User can set the parameters to be adjusted by the Knob. When the Knob is
rotated, corresponding parameter value on the interface will be changed. The
following six types of parameters can be adjusted by Knob:
⚫ Volt: grounding level of voltage channel;
⚫ Ampe: grounding level of current channel;
⚫ DVM: grounding level of DVM channel;
⚫ T/Lev: trigger level;
⚫ T/Del: trigger delay;
⚫ T/Div: horizontal calibration (scanning speed).
